YOKOGAWA Weidmüller 8662560000 Terminal Module is a universal terminal module under Yokogawa Electric, which is compatible with the CENTUM VP and CS series distributed control systems (DCS). It is usually used in conjunction with Yokogawa analog input modules, serving for signal conversion, electrical isolation and safe wiring between field instruments and control systems.
It provides a stable and reliable access channel for analog signals (e.g., 4-20mA, thermocouples, thermal resistors, etc.) in industrial processes, ensuring the accuracy and safety of data acquisition. Widely applied in process industries such as petrochemicals, chemicals, electric power and pharmaceuticals, this module can meet the requirements of signal transmission and anti-interference in harsh industrial environments. Meanwhile, it supports rapid maintenance and hot-swappable operation, enhancing system availability and engineering efficiency.

Core Parameters
Compatible Systems: CENTUM VP and CS series DCS.
Signal Types: Compatible with DC voltage, standard 4-20mA signals, thermocouples (TC), resistance temperature detectors (RTD), DC current (external shunt resistor required), digital inputs (voltage/contact), etc.
Channel Configuration: 8-channel isolated analog input channels with electrical isolation between channels to effectively suppress signal crosstalk.
Terminal Type: M3 screw terminals equipped with transparent covers. It supports integral plug-and-play, enabling convenient wiring and excellent vibration resistance.
Electrical Isolation: Optical-electrical isolation is provided between channels and between channels and the system. The insulation resistance is ≥ 100 MΩ (at 500V DC) with a withstand voltage of 500V AC, ensuring the safety of both the system and personnel.
Contact Material: High-conductivity copper alloy with gold plating. It features low contact resistance and oxidation resistance, guaranteeing low-loss signal transmission.
Environmental Adaptability: The operating temperature ranges from 0℃ to 50℃, and the relative humidity is 5% to 90% RH (non-condensing), making it adaptable to temperature and humidity fluctuations in industrial sites.
Mounting Method: DIN rail or cabinet rack mounting is available. The dimensions are approximately 127×229×178mm and the weight is about 0.3kg, which helps save installation space.
Protection Functions: Equipped with shielding grounding terminals (FG/SHIELD) to suppress common-mode noise and ground loop interference. It supports hot swapping, allowing live maintenance and improving the system's continuous operation capability.

Core Functions
Signal Adaptation and Conversion: Compatible with various commonly used industrial signal types. It can connect field instrument signals to the DCS without additional signal conversion equipment, simplifying the system architecture and reducing equipment costs.
Electrical Isolation Protection: Adopts optoelectronic isolation technology to isolate the field-side and system-side circuits, preventing field faults such as surges and short circuits from affecting the control system. Meanwhile, it avoids signal interference between different channels, ensuring measurement accuracy.
Convenient Wiring and Maintenance: Uses modular pluggable terminal blocks, combined with clear channel identifiers (such as CH1+, CH1-, COM, etc.), which greatly reduces the wiring error rate. It supports hot swapping, enabling maintenance without shutting down the machine and shortening fault handling time.
Anti-Interference Design: Independent shielded grounding terminals can quickly connect to the shielding layer of field cables, suppressing electromagnetic interference (EMI) and radio frequency interference (RFI), and ensuring high-fidelity transmission of weak signals. It is especially suitable for high-precision measurement under complex working conditions.
System Compatibility: Seamlessly integrates with Yokogawa analog input modules (such as F3XA series, GX90XA series), supports on-line system upgrade and expansion, and is suitable for industrial control projects of different scales.
